Course details for the Leinster League event at Cahore Dunes on Sunday, April 27th, are as follows: Brown 9.1K 28 controls Blue 7.2K 27 controls Green 4.8K 18 controls Light Green 3.5K 13 controls Red 4.6K 12 controls Orange 3.9K 13 controls Yellow 2.4K 11 controls
The small paths in the sand dunes have been removed from the Brown, to add an extra challenge.
Climb is minimal on most courses and is not stated because of the variety of routes over the dunes.
There is no Short Green but hopefully the Light Green will provide enough technical challenge.
There are extensive paths through the dunes and the less distinct ones are not mapped. But note that running on the soft sand on the more distinct paths is more tiring than running off the paths.
The Brown, Blue, and Green are on A3 paper. The Red, Yellow, Orange, and Light Green are on A4. The Brown, Blue, Red, and Orange scales are 1:7500. The Green, Light Green and Yellow scales are 1:5000.
As requested by the Parks and Wildlife ranger some areas are marked with the out of bounds purple hatching, because of dune erosion and nesting terns near the river outflow. Please avoid these areas. They are not marked on the ground.
The areas closest to the sea are very sandy and are designated as Open rather than sandy ground. This is because of the pdf file size created by purple pen. The rest of the dunes are designated as rough open. The vegetation increases and is more varied the further inland you go in the dunes.
